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Buckingham Palace to witness the Changing of the Guard ceremony. Then, head to Hyde Park for a relaxing morning picnic by the Serpentine Lake. For a budget-friendly lunch, grab some delicious street food at Borough Market. In the afternoon, explore the kid-friendly exhibits at the Natural History Museum. End your day with a stroll along the South Bank, enjoying street performances and views of the Thames River.
In the afternoon, take a leisurely boat ride on the Thames River with a budget-friendly ticket. Visit the interactive Science Museum to engage the whole family in educational fun. For dinner, explore the diverse food options at Camden Market, offering budget-friendly street food from around the world. Don't miss the chance to see the famous street art in the area.
For a relaxing evening, head to Regent's Park for a family-friendly outdoor theater performance or enjoy a picnic in the park. Alternatively, catch the sunset at Primrose Hill for panoramic views of the city skyline.
Start your day with a visit to the historic Tower of London, where you can see the Crown Jewels and explore medieval architecture. Enjoy a budget-friendly lunch at a local pub near the Tower Bridge. In the afternoon, take a stroll along the vibrant streets of Covent Garden, filled with street performers and unique shops. Visit the London Transport Museum for an interactive experience with the city's transportation history.
Continue your afternoon with a visit to the iconic British Museum, offering free admission to explore world history and culture. Grab a budget-friendly dinner at a cozy restaurant in the lively Soho neighborhood, known for its diverse food options. Take a leisurely walk through Leicester Square and Piccadilly Circus in the evening, enjoying the bustling atmosphere.
For a memorable evening, enjoy a family-friendly West End musical on a budget by purchasing discounted tickets at the TKTS booth in Leicester Square. End your night with a stroll along the illuminated South Bank, taking in the stunning views of the city lights reflected on the Thames River.
